본 고안은 팬히터의 버너에 관한 것으로서 특히 버너의 상부 양측으로 형성된 날개부에 이에 결합되는 염공판의 위치 설정구가 형성된 팬히터의 버너에 관한 것이다.The present invention relates to a burner of a fan heater, and more particularly, to a burner of a fan heater in which a positioning hole of a salt plate is coupled to a wing formed on both sides of an upper part of the burner.
일반적으로 팬히터의 버너 상부에는 중앙부가 상방으로 절곡되어 염공이 형성되고 그 양측부에 흡기공이 형성된 염공판이 결합되어지는데 기존의 버너는 내부에 가스통로를 갖고 상단부를 연장하여 양측으로 절곡시킨 날개부에 다수의 흡기공이 형성되어져 그 날개부의 상면에 상기의 염공판이 결합되도록 하였는바, 염공판을 결합함에 있어서 버너 날개부의 흡기공과 염공판에 형성된 흡기공들을 일치시킨후 용접수단으로 결합하여야 하는데 염공판을 버너 상부의 정위치에 낮춘 상태에서 용접을 하더라도 염공판의 현상태를 유지하여 줄 수 있는 아무런 구조가 형성되어 있지 않아 염공판이 밀리는 등의 유동으로 인하여 정위치에 결합되지 않는 일이 빈번하게 발생되어 불량률이 높아지는 등 이에 따른 많은 문제점이 뒤따르게 된다.In general, the upper portion of the fan heater is bent upwards in the center portion is formed salt hole and the inlet hole formed in the inlet hole is coupled to both sides of the existing burner has a gas passage inside and extending the upper end of the wing portion bent to both sides A plurality of intake holes are formed in the upper surface of the wing portion so that the above-described salt plate is coupled. In joining the salt plate, the intake hole formed in the burner wing portion and the intake hole formed in the salt plate must be matched and then joined by welding means. Even if welding is made while lowering the stencil to the upper position of the burner, it is frequently not connected to the throttle due to the flow of the salt stencil because there is no structure that can maintain the current state of the stencil. Many problems are accompanied by such a problem that the defect rate increases.
따라서 본 고안자는 상기의 문제점을 해결하기 위한 목적으로 좀더 편리하게 염공판을 버너의 상부에 결합시킬 수 있도록 개량한 본 고안의 팬히터의 버너를 제공하려는 것으로서 이를 첨부한 도면에 의거하여 상세히 설명하면 다음과 같다.Therefore, the present inventors are intended to provide a burner of the fan heater of the present invention that has been improved to more conveniently combine the salt plate to the upper part of the burner for the purpose of solving the above problems. Same as
제1도에 도시한 바와같이 내부의 가스통로(1a)와 상단의 양측 날개부(1b)에 흡기공(1c)이 천공되어 그 상부에 염공(2a)과 흡기공(2b)이 마련된 염공판(2)이 결합되어지는 팬히터의 버너(1)에 있어서 상기 버너(1)의 날개부(1b)에 대각선 방향으로 양 끝단부에 염공판(2)의 위치 설정구(3)를 2개 이상 상방으로 절곡시킨 것이다.As shown in FIG. 1, the inlet hole 1c is drilled in the inner gas passage 1a and both wing portions 1b of the upper end, and a salt hole plate having a salt hole 2a and an intake hole 2b formed thereon. In the burner (1) of the fan heater to which (2) is coupled, at least two positioning holes (3) of the salt hole plate (2) at both ends in diagonal directions to the wing portion (1b) of the burner (1). It is bent upwards.
미설명부호 4는 송풍덕트, 5는 송풍팬이다.Reference numeral 4 is a blower duct, and 5 is a blower fan.
이와같이 구성된 본 고안의 버너(1)에 염공판(2)를 조립하고자 할 때에는 버너(1)의 날개부(1b)에 염공판(2)을 올려놓으면 염공판(2)에 형성된 흡기공(2b) 중에서 위치 설정구(3)와 대응되는 위치에 형성된 흡기공(2b)이 상기 위치 설정구(3)에 제2도와 같이 끼워지게 되어 염공판(2)이 버너(1)의 정확한 위치에 올려짐으로써 이 상태에서 용접작업을 행하면 염공판(2)은 유동됨이 없이 정확한 위치에 결합되어진다.When assembling the salt plate 2 in the burner 1 of the present invention configured as described above, the salt plate 2 is placed on the wing 1b of the burner 1, and the intake hole 2b formed in the salt plate 2 is formed. Intake hole (2b) formed in the position corresponding to the positioning hole (3) is inserted into the positioning hole (3) as shown in FIG. 2 so that the stencil plate (2) is raised to the correct position of the burner (1) As a result, when the welding operation is performed in this state, the stencil plate 2 is coupled to the correct position without flowing.
즉 작업자가 염공판(2)의 위치 및 양 흡기공(1c)(2b)을 일치시켜야 한다는 부담이 없이 단지 위치 설정구(3)에 맞춰 염공판(2)을 올려놓으면 자연스럽게 고정됨과 동시에 양 흡기공(1c)(2b) 또한 일치되어진다.That is, the operator does not have to burden the position of the stencil plate 2 and the intake holes 1c and 2b so that the stencil plate 2 is placed in accordance with the positioning hole 3 and is fixed naturally. Balls 1c and 2b are also matched.
이상에서와 같이 본 고안에 의하면 버너의 날개부에 간단한 위치 설정구를 형성함으로써 염공판을 결합하는 데에 편리함을 주게됨을 물론 제품의 불량률을 줄일 수 있는 유용한 고안인 것이다.As described above, according to the present invention, a simple positioning tool is formed on the wing portion of the burner, which is useful for combining the salt plates, as well as reducing the defective rate of the product.
